Case Summary: T.P.(C) No. 865/2005 Anjali v. Manoj Kumar Gangadharan (Heard: 12/12/2005) Anjali sought transfer of her husband's divorce petition (filed under Section 13 of the Hindu Marriage Act, 1955) from the Family Court at Thrissur, Kerala to Bhopal, Madhya Pradesh. The Supreme Court dismissed the transfer petition but imposed conditions: the respondent-husband must bear all round-trip travel expenses (III tier A.C.) and accommodation costs for the petitioner-wife and her companion for court appearances at Thrissur.
